What is a Built-In Oven?
A built-in oven is a type of cooking appliance that is created to be installed within kitchen area cabinets, creating a structured appearance that incorporates seamlessly with other kitchen area aspects. Unlike freestanding ovens that rest on the flooring, built-in designs are installed at eye level or beneath counter tops, making them more available and ergonomic.
Types of Built-In Ovens
Built-in ovens can be found in various types, each with its special cooking capabilities and benefits:
Single Ovens: These are the most common type, providing one roomy cooking chamber. Suitable for smaller sized kitchens or for those who primarily prepare for a couple of people.

Wall Ovens: These ovens are installed into the wall at eye level, making them easy to access and removing the need to flex down. Wall ovens typically are available in single or double setups.
Steam Ovens: Combining traditional baking with steam cooking, these ovens retain moisture in food, causing much healthier cooking alternatives and boosted flavors.
Convection Ovens: Featuring a fan that distributes hot air, convection ovens make sure even cooking and browning, substantially minimizing cooking times and improving results.

Considerations When Choosing a Built-In Oven
Size and Fit: Measure the area where you plan to set up the oven to ensure a perfect fit. Requirement sizes typically include 24, 27, and 30 inches broad, however comprehending your kitchen area's design is crucial.
Type of Fuel: Built-in ovens are offered in gas, electric, and dual fuel options. Consider your cooking choices and kitchen area setup when choosing the fuel type.
Features and Functions: Identify the features that matter most to you-- convection cooking, steam functions, wise technology, or self-cleaning alternatives-- and choose a design that aligns with your cooking routines.
Budget: Built-in ovens can vary significantly in price. Develop a spending plan early on, and check out models within that range, balancing functions and quality.
Installation: Proper setup is important for built-in ovens. Think about employing an expert to ensure security and right performance, particularly when dealing with gas connections.
